Cindy K. Miller (Member) born Paterson, New Jersey; admitted to bar, 1978, New Jersey and U.S. District Court, District of New Jersey. Education: Indiana University (B.A., with honors and distinction, 1975); Temple University (J.D., 1978). Phi Beta Kappa. Adjunct Professor, Political Science Department, Kean University, Union, New Jersey, 2001. Faculty, New Jersey Judicial College. Member, Superior Court of New Jersey Roster of Court Approved Mediators for Civil Rights, Commercial Transactions, Complex Commercial Disputes, General Contract Matters, Employment Disputes, General Equity Matters, Tenancy. Senior Deputy Attorney General and Deputy Attorney General, New Jersey, 1983-2000. Member, Supreme Court of New Jersey District Ethics Committee for Union County (District XII), 2004-2008. Member: New Jersey State Bar Association (Past Chairperson and Member, Consumer Protection Law Committee; Member, Legislative Standing Committee). Reported Cases: Gennari v. Weichert Co. Realtors, 148 N.J. 582, 691 A.2d 350 (1997); Greer v. New Jersey Bureau of Securities, 291 N.J. Super. 365, 677 A.2d 763 (App. Div. 1994); Del Tufo v. National Republican Senatorial Committee, 248 N.J. Super. 684, 591 A.2d 1040 (Ch. Div. 1991); Morgan v. AirBrook Limousine, Inc., 211 N.J. Super. 84, 510 A.2d 1197 (Law Div. 1986); Matter of Request for Solid Waste Utility Customer Lists, 106 N.J. 508, 524 A.2d 386 (1987); Freehold Borough v. Freehold Township, 193 N.J. Super. 724, 475 A.2d 691 (App. Div. 1984); Petition of Hackensack Water Company, 196 N.J. Super. 162, 481 A.2d 1160 (App. Div. 1984); Goldberg v. Hale, 172 N.J. Super. 31, 410 A.2d 706 (App. Div. 1980); Drew v. Pullen, 172 N.J. Super. 570, 412 A.2d 1331 (App. Div. 1980). Practice Areas: Consumer Law; Labor and Employment; Civil Practice; International Adoption Finalization; Debtor and Creditor Remedies.
